999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

一種基于卡爾曼濾波的超寬帶室內定位算法

2017-11-01 07:19:31閆保芳毛慶洲
傳感器與微系統 2017年10期
關鍵詞:卡爾曼濾波環境

閆保芳, 毛慶洲

(武漢大學 測繪遙感信息工程國家重點實驗室,湖北 武漢 430079)

一種基于卡爾曼濾波的超寬帶室內定位算法

閆保芳, 毛慶洲

(武漢大學測繪遙感信息工程國家重點實驗室,湖北武漢430079)

為了減小室內環境中障礙物對超寬帶(UWB)傳感器測距結果的影響,提出了一種基于卡爾曼濾波(KF)的超寬帶室內定位算法。利用超寬帶接收信號的信噪比區分視距和非視距環境,給出了超寬帶傳感器測距性能最小二乘標定模型,減小測距系統誤差;判斷相鄰測距差分是否在閾值范圍內,否則用卡爾曼濾波先驗估計替代后驗估計處理測距結果,由此減弱多徑效應和非視距誤差對測距的影響;用擴展卡爾曼濾波器(EKF)實現室內定位。實驗結果表明:算法在復雜室內環境中可達到亞米級的動態實時定位精度。

超寬帶; 室內定位; 標定; 卡爾曼濾波; 擴展卡爾曼濾波

0 引 言

目前,常用的超寬帶[1~4](ultra-wideband,UWB)技術室內定位方法有到達角(angle of arrival,AOA),到達時間(time of arrival,TOA),接收信號強度(receive signal strength,RSS),到達時間差(time difference of arrival,TDOA),一般采用其中的一種或幾種混合作為定位方法[5]。Irahhauten Z等人[6]提出了基于信號達到角度和時間(TOA/AOA)的室內定位方法,算法只需要一個錨節點(anchor node,AN),非視距(non-line of sight,NLOS)定位估計精度較高,而視距(line of sight,LOS)定位估計精度較傳統TOA定位方法低。Wang T等人[7]增加參考節點(refe-rence node,RN),計算移動節點 (mobile node,MN)和RN到AN的TDOA的定位方法,獲得較高的室內定位精度,但是需要的節點數目較多,且定位算法復雜。Suski W等人[8]建立了測量噪聲地圖,在粒子濾波框架下將UWB室內定位導航精度提高了30%,但建立測量噪聲地圖需要測大量數據且環境普適性不強。

上述定位方法關于測量值的方程組通常情況下均為非線性的,為了求出最優解,提出了具有不同精度和復雜度的定位算法。常見的有:Chan定位算法[9],在LOS環境中定位精度較高,但NLOS環境下需要靠增加AN改善定位精度;Taylor級數展開法[10],計算速度較Chan算法快,NLOS環境下定位精度也有所改善,但是Taylor算法初值精度低時會發散;徑向基函數(radial basis function,RBF)神經網絡定位算法[11]與前兩者相比,在NLOS環境下遠距離的定位精度較高,而一般室內測量距離較短,因此并不適用。

相較而言,卡爾曼濾波(Kalman filtering,KF)利用某一時刻測量值和上一時刻估計值來預測當前值,具有良好的動態跟蹤定位的效果,遞歸計算復雜度低[12]。本文采用帶有觀測量差分閾值判斷后驗估計的KF以減小測距過程中環境、電氣等引入的噪聲,最后利用擴展卡爾曼濾波(extended Kalman filtering,EKF)實現動態跟蹤定位。

1 UWB傳感器測距原理與標定模型

本文選用P410超寬帶傳感器,利用超寬帶信號在2只傳感器之間的雙向飛行時間(two-way time of flight,TWTOF)進行測距[13]。

UWB傳感器TWTOF測距原理如圖1所示。傳感器A在τtxA時刻發送測距請求信號,傳感器B在τtxB時刻接收到信號后,在τtxB時刻發送測距響應信號,傳感器A在τtxA時刻接收并解析響應信號數據包,計算信號在兩個節點之間的飛行時間再乘以光速c,即可得兩節點間距AB。TWTOF測距方程為

(1)

LOS和NLOS環境中影響UWB測距精度的因素不同,需分別標定。本文選擇一次函數作為傳感器標定模型[14,15]。

1.1 LOS環境

受電氣轉換時間、天線和天線連接器電氣延遲等因素的影響,測距響應時延τdelay存在誤差。首先需要標定UWB傳感器的LOS測距性能。假設傳感器P0與Pi,i=1,2,3之間距離的測量值0,i和真值d0,i關系如下

(2)

式中v0,i(d0,i)為與真實值相關的絕對誤差函數,假設v0,i為一次函數

v0,i(d)=a0,id+b0,i

(3)

d0,i=(0,i-b0,i)/(1+a0,i)

(4)

1.2 NLOS環境

NLOS條件下,信號直接路徑上存在障礙物,一方面影響信號的檢測精度,另一方面影響信號穿過障礙物時的速度,使圖1所示的τrxB和τrxA數值偏大。障礙物對信號的衰減作用使NLOS環境接收信號強度較LOS環境弱很多,可以將接收信號的信噪比作為測距條件的判斷依據。對于相同材質的障礙物,NLOS誤差可以視為常數,在LOS標定后的基礎上式(4)可以改寫為

(5)

式中SNR為接收信號信噪比;TSNR為測距條件判定閾值;vNLOS為非視距誤差常數,需要實地測量確定。

2 測距值KF

首先將標定后的傳感器數據進行卡爾曼濾波處理,獲得精度較高的連續測距值,方可進行定位。短時間內,MN與AN的距離rk可視為均勻變化

(6)

由式(6)構造離散卡爾曼濾波的狀態方程為

xk=Axk-1+wk-1

(7)

離散卡爾曼濾波的觀測方程為

zk=Hxk+vk

(8)

式中zk為第k個采樣點距離測量值;wk和vk分別為過程噪聲和觀測噪聲;H=[1,0]。由文獻[16]可得

(9)

(10)

(11)

(12)

(13)

創新生態系統核心企業主導能力測度研究—基于扎根理論的探索…………………………邊偉軍,密淑泉,羅公利,王玉英(1,24)

(14)

3 EKF跟蹤定位

TOA定位原理如圖1所示,三個錨節點位于同一水平面上,以P101為原點O,P101—P102為X軸,P101—P103為Y軸,垂直OXY方向為Z軸,建立空間直角坐標系。

圖1 TOA定位原理

設MNP100坐標為(x,y,z),ANP101,P102,P103坐標為(xi,yi,zi),i=1,2,3,TOA定位原理如圖1所示,則MN和AN之間的距離為

(15)

式(15)所示的MN坐標(x,y,z)和觀測距離ri之間的關系是非線性的,即測量方程非線性,需要將預測和狀態估計線性化后再應用于KF。因此,為了提高MN動態定位精度,本文采用EKF來估計MN坐標。

假設P100運動狀態模型為

Xk=fk-1(Xk-1)+Wk-1,Wk~N(0,Qk)

(16)

非線性測量模型為

Zk=hk(Xk)+Vk,Vk~N(0,Rk)

(17)

式中Xk為MN坐標和相應坐標軸運動速度向量,Xk=[x(k),y(k),z(k),vz(k),vy(k),vz(k)]T,vi(k)=(i(k)-i(k-1))/T,i=x,y,z;Qk為預測噪聲向量Wk的協方差矩陣;Zk為MN距AN觀測距離向量,Zk=(r1(k),r2(k),r3(k))T;Rk為觀測噪聲向量Vk的協方差矩陣;T為采樣時間間隔。則擴展卡爾曼濾波方程為

(18)

(19)

(20)

(21)

(22)

4 實驗與結果分析

實驗流程如下:1)用最小二乘法標定傳感器;2)采用帶有觀測量差分閾值判斷后驗估計的KF提高測距精度,減小隨機誤差對測距的影響;并估計含粗大誤差的采樣點,減弱粗大誤差影響;3)通過非線性EKF估計MN位置

4.1 UWB傳感器測距標定實驗

在室內LOS環境中,從1~22m分別每隔1m靜態測量2000次距離,取2000次測量均值作為該距離下的測量值,用最小二乘擬合測距誤差與真實距離值間的函數關系,LOS環境標定結果如圖2所示。

圖2 LOS環境標定

從圖2可以看出:真實距離小于3m時,測距絕對誤差較大。由于距離太近,UWB信號在空中飛行時間過短,使圖1中傳感器A接收的響應信號被自己發射的測距請求信號干擾,標定UWB傳感器測距值可以減小這種干擾引入的誤差。

在室內LOS和NLOS條件下從1~16m分別每隔1m靜態測距1000次,取1000次測量均值,用一次函數最小二乘擬合信噪比(signal to noise ratio,SNR)與測距的關系,如圖3所示。其中,NLOS環境中2只傳感器間隔厚度約為250mm的空心磚墻。

圖3 SNR與測距關系

由圖3知:傳感器測量值相同時,LOS環境中的SNR較NLOS環境大,且隨著距離的增加,二者之間的差值逐漸增大。本文取LOS與NLOS環境中,SNR和傳感器測量值擬合曲線的角平分線作為測距環境的決策閾值曲線。獲得傳感器測距值后,根據決策閾值曲線求出此測距值對應的環境決策SNR閾值,即式(5)中的TSNR,對傳感器進行標定。

4.2 測距卡爾曼濾波

為了提高測距精度,減小多徑效應與NLOS的影響,用KF處理測距,結果如圖4所示。

圖4 卡爾曼濾波測距處理

LOS環境中以多徑效應測距誤差為主,UWB信號具有良好抗多徑效應的能力,從圖5(a)可以看出整體測距誤差較小,動態實時定位過程中,差分閾值判斷先驗估計代替后驗估計的KF可以很好估計個別含有粗差的測距值,削減突刺平滑測距采樣數據,KF處理后曲線較原始測量曲線平滑,且覆蓋了原來的測距曲線,具有良好跟蹤效果。

MN在NLOS環境運動過程中,與AN之間環境變化導致接收到的UWB信號強度和飛行時間劇烈變化,如圖5(b)所示,測距采樣曲線有很多毛刺平滑度低。KF處理后,測距采樣波形整體較平滑,有效減弱了NLOS誤差的影響。

4.3 EKF定位實驗

采用EKF能減弱測距誤差對定位的影響,動態定位效果如圖5所示。

圖5 EKF定位

圖5(a)為圖4(a)對應的定位軌跡,在56m×7.8m的室內LOS環境中進行實驗,MN實際運動軌跡為一個長方框。圖5(b)為在26m×7m的室內LOS環境中實驗結果,MN實際運動軌跡為回字形。圖5(c)為圖4(b)對應的定位軌跡,在室內NLOS環境中沿著厚度約為250mm的空心紅磚墻繞行。

從圖5可以看出:EKF后的軌跡較三邊測量定位軌跡平滑,受測距誤差影響較小,且更貼近實際運動軌跡。UWB在室內LOS環境中定位精度較高,尺寸較大的室內平均動態定位精度達到1m,小尺寸室內最大動態定位誤差在0.2m以內,室內NLOS環境中動態定位精度在1m左右。

5 結束語

本文通過分析實際測量誤差值,采用一次函數作為傳感器測距的誤差校正模型,減小了系統誤差的影響,并利用KF,減弱了多徑效應和非視距誤差。這兩步數據處理有效地提高了測距精度,最后采用EKF提高了定位精度。本文僅用3個錨節點,達到了1m的綜合室內動態定位精度,適用于機場、火車站和會展等室內公共場所的導航定位。由于本文僅使用UWB傳感器,缺少多余觀測量,因此,對于誤差較大的數據,KF估計效果不理想。后續工作中可以添加加速度計、陀螺儀等多傳感器組合導航,進一步提高室內定位精度。

[1] Zhang J,Orlik P V,Sahinoglu Z,et al.UWB systems for wireless sensor networks[C]∥Proceedings of the IEEE,2009:313-331.

[2] 王小輝,汪云甲,張 偉.基于RFID的室內定位技術評述[J].傳感器與微系統,2009,28(2):1-7.

[3] 劉小康,張 翔,方 爽,等.基于ZigBee無線傳感器網絡的一種室內定位新方法[J].傳感器與微系統,2013,32(11):29-36.

[4] 張令文,楊 剛.超寬帶室內定位關鍵技術[J].數據采集與處理,2013(6):706-713.

[5] Irahhauten Z,Nikookar H,Klepper M.A joint ToA /DoA technique for2D /3D UWB localization in indoor multipath environment[C]∥Internatimal Conference on Communications (ICC),Ottawa,ON,2012.

[6] 歐陽昱.基于超寬帶的室內定位算法研究[D].南京:南京郵電大學,2013.

[7] Wang T,Chen X,Ge N,et al.Error analysis and experimental study on indoor UWB TDOA localization with reference tag[C]∥APCC,Denpasar,2013.

[8] Suski W,Banerjee S,Hoover A.Using a map of measurement noise to improve UWB indoor position tracking[J].IEEE Tran-sactions on Instrumentation and Measurement,2013,62(8):2228-2236.

[9] 章堅武,唐 兵,秦 峰.Chan定位算法在三維空間定位中的應用[J].計算機仿真,2009,26(1):323-326.

[10] 蔣文美,王 玫.一種基于TOA的UWB直接Taylor復合定位算法[J].桂林電子工業學院學報,2006,26(1):1-5.

[11] 毛永毅,李明遠,張寶軍.一種 NLOS 環境下的 TOA/AOA 定位算法[J].電子與信息學報,2009,31(1):37-40.

[12] Zhang Y,Zhang R,Miao W,et al.An indoor positioning algorithm for mobile objects based on track smoothing[C]∥2014IEEE7th International Conference on Advanced Infocomm Technology (ICAIT),IEEE,2014:252-259.

[13] 孟宏偉.超寬帶無線定位方法研究[D].長春:吉林大學,2007.

[14] Monica S,Ferrari G.An experimental model for UWB distance measurements and its application to localization problems[C]∥2014 IEEE International Conference on Ultra-WideBand (ICUWB),IEEE,2014:297-302.

[15] Zoltan K,Charles T,Dorota G,et al.Performance analysis of UWB technology for indoor positioning[C]∥International Technical Meeting of The Institute of Navigation,San Diego,California,2014.

[16] Mohinder S Grewal,Angus P Andrews.Kalman filtering:Theory and practice using Matlab[M].2nd ed.New York:A Wiley-Interscience Publication,2001:170-184.

AnUWBindoorpositioningalgorithmbasedonKalmanfiltering

YAN Bao-fang, MAO Qing-zhou

(StateKeyLaboratoryofInformationEngineeringinSurvey,MappingandRemoteSensing,WuhanUniversity,Wuhan430079,China)

In order to eliminate the effects of indoor obstacles lead to ultra-wideband(UWB) ranging result,present an UWB indoor localization algorithm based on Kalman filtering.By using signal noise ratio of UWB to distinguish line of sight from non-line of sight environment,give least squares calibration models for ultra-wideband sensor ranging performance to reduce the distance measuring system error.To weaken multipath effects and effect of non-line of sight error on ranging,use Kalman filtering priori estimation to replace posterior estimation to process ranging result.Extended Kalman filter is used to achieve indoor positioning.Experimental results prove that,the algorithm has sub-meter high dynamic realtime positioning precision in complex indoor environments.

ultra wide band(UWB); indoor positioning; calibration; Kalman filtering(KF); extended Kalman filtering(EKF)

10.13873/J.1000—9787(2017)10—0137—04

2016—11—02

TN 929

A

1000—9787(2017)10—0137—04

閆保芳(1992-),女,碩士研究生,研究方向為室內導航、3S集成。

猜你喜歡
卡爾曼濾波環境
長期鍛煉創造體內抑癌環境
一種用于自主學習的虛擬仿真環境
孕期遠離容易致畸的環境
不能改變環境,那就改變心境
環境
改進的擴展卡爾曼濾波算法研究
測控技術(2018年12期)2018-11-25 09:37:34
孕期遠離容易致畸的環境
基于遞推更新卡爾曼濾波的磁偶極子目標跟蹤
基于模糊卡爾曼濾波算法的動力電池SOC估計
電源技術(2016年9期)2016-02-27 09:05:39
基于擴展卡爾曼濾波的PMSM無位置傳感器控制
電源技術(2015年1期)2015-08-22 11:16:28
主站蜘蛛池模板: 国产精品永久在线| 黄色国产在线| 日本国产精品| 欧美另类一区| 二级特黄绝大片免费视频大片| 九色视频在线免费观看| 天堂在线视频精品| 19国产精品麻豆免费观看| 三上悠亚一区二区| 日本免费a视频| 国产精品污视频| 国产本道久久一区二区三区| 中文字幕乱码中文乱码51精品| 国产成人成人一区二区| 日韩毛片视频| 露脸真实国语乱在线观看| 免费全部高H视频无码无遮掩| 国产人成乱码视频免费观看| 2022国产无码在线| 亚洲国产成人久久精品软件| 国产制服丝袜无码视频| 免费无遮挡AV| 亚洲综合精品第一页| 国产第一色| a级毛片免费看| 国产精品福利在线观看无码卡| 国产欧美日韩专区发布| 中文字幕欧美日韩| 国产无吗一区二区三区在线欢| 日韩中文字幕亚洲无线码| 国产激爽大片在线播放| 国产一区在线观看无码| 欧美一级大片在线观看| 国产正在播放| 亚洲伊人久久精品影院| 国产一级视频久久| 色哟哟国产精品| 亚洲欧美另类日本| 久久狠狠色噜噜狠狠狠狠97视色| 国产精品短篇二区| 嫩草国产在线| 日本在线亚洲| 永久成人无码激情视频免费| 免费一级毛片| 无码av免费不卡在线观看| 中文字幕永久在线观看| 欧美日韩亚洲国产主播第一区| 99精品视频播放| 欧美日一级片| 久久黄色毛片| 无码aⅴ精品一区二区三区| 国产人碰人摸人爱免费视频| 强奷白丝美女在线观看| 成人无码一区二区三区视频在线观看| 国产免费a级片| 日本免费福利视频| 亚洲人成网站观看在线观看| 亚洲国产天堂在线观看| 51国产偷自视频区视频手机观看| 国产毛片片精品天天看视频| 国产成人永久免费视频| 中文字幕 91| 免费中文字幕一级毛片| 亚洲综合专区| 青青草国产精品久久久久| 亚洲男人天堂久久| 国产美女人喷水在线观看| 亚洲精品欧美日本中文字幕| 亚洲无码熟妇人妻AV在线| 波多野结衣AV无码久久一区| 日韩黄色大片免费看| 国产亚洲视频在线观看| 亚洲小视频网站| 亚欧成人无码AV在线播放| 欧美精品成人| 色九九视频| 国产视频 第一页| 婷婷六月在线| 91在线视频福利| 中文字幕日韩视频欧美一区| 精品国产免费观看| 国产黑丝一区|